When deciding which amp will push this or that.....check the fuses

for every 10A worth of fuses, thats 100watts of power.

so if your legacy amp says 1000watts but only has a 30A fuse in it, guess what?

But even if you have say an amp with 5 30A fuses you still are not getting the full

1500watts if you havent upgraded the big 3 and your alternater/battery.

and BTW, there is an credible argument going on that you cant even hear the

difference in amps, as long as the total power ( and total fuses) are the same.

all else being equal just look for features you like, such as remote bass, shiny chrome finish , number of channels, etc.

PS. on unfused amps (RF), look for some sort of certificate thats states the total max power or check what the manufactor recommends for the in-line fuse.

 
i always used that "check the fuse" trick and its pretty reliable. of course if the amp your checking is fully regulated the fuse might be lower than the actual power it can produce since it doesnt rely on brute voltage..
